Subject: Re: [PATCH 0/4] Add KRYO2XX Errata / mitigations data

On 2020-11-05 15:03, Will Deacon wrote:
> Hi Konrad,
> 
> [+Jeffrey]
> 
> On Thu, Nov 05, 2020 at 12:22:09AM +0100, Konrad Dybcio wrote:
>> This series adds Spectre mitigations and errata data for
>> Qualcomm KRYO2XX Gold (big) and Silver (LITTLE) series of
>> CPU cores, used for example in MSM8998 and SDM660-series SoCs.
>> 
>> Konrad Dybcio (4):
>>   arm64: Add MIDR value for KRYO2XX gold/silver CPU cores
>>   arm64: kpti: Add KRYO2XX gold/silver CPU cores to kpti safelist
>>   arm64: proton-pack: Add KRYO2XX silver CPUs to spectre-v2 safe-list
>>   arm64: cpu_errata: Apply Erratum 845719 to KRYO2XX Silver
> 
> This mostly looks fine to me, but I've added Jeffrey to check the MIDRs
> because he's my go-to person for the Qualcomm numbering scheme.
> 
> Jeffrey -- please can you check these patches [1], especially the last 
> patch
> which has some cryptic revision number in there too?

Jeffrey can confirm this, but the MIDR is right and the cryptic revision
maps to cortex r0p4.
